    Which of these 10 players would you most want to keep?

    Bacuna joins Sean Morrison, Joe Ralls, Aden Flint, Will Vaulks, Marlon Pack, Ciaron Brown, Josh Murphy, Isaac Vassell and Alex Smithies as players who have only five months left to run on their deals.

    For me it would be in the order below but tbh assuming we don’t lose other players, the bottom five could all go and the top 3 would be the ones I would most like to stay.
    1. smithies
    2. ralls
    3. flint
    4. Morrison
    5. Vaulks
    6. Pack
    7. Murphy
    8. Brown
    9. Bacuna
    10. Vassal

    Re: Which of these 10 players would you most want to keep?

    1. smithies
    still a good keeper at this level, if we can agree a sensible wage I wouldn't be against keeping him, but Phillips is good enough and we could probably put the money to good use elsewhere.
    2. ralls
    brings energy and quality to the midfield, good player at this level, will be in demand. would like to keep if it fits into our budget.
    3. flint
    still a good player, but the level is starting to drop with age. possibly worth a 1 year deal if the money is right.
    4. Morrison
    Captain and influential player. hasn't been at his best in a back 3. again I'd keep if it was sensible money wise.
    5. Vaulks
    he's done OK. the long throws and occasional long range strike will be missed, but I'd move him on, doesn't do enough defensively or attacking wise for me.
    6. Pack
    important role in the team, but everything he does is so slow, Wintle should be keeping him out of the side now. move on.
    7. Murphy
    should have been a good player for us, one of our most expensive ever signings. I've been willing him to succeed for years but I think we are all resigned to the fact that it isn't going to happen. how much of that is down to him and how much is down to managers not using him well, but he is a shadow of the player we thought we had signed. definitely don't keep.
    8. Brown
    left footed CBs are very in demand, but I'm yet to see anything from brown to suggest he's good enough.aside from a good loan spell in Scotland. move on
    9. Bacuna
    he's been ok for us, but for someone we paid that much money for, and in his reported wage he should be one of the first names on the team sheet. on paper it is odd that as someone who has played as a premier League full back and has played as an attacking midfielder that we've never tried him at wing back. having seen him play I'm not that surprised.
    he has some ability, but doesn't bring it often enough.
    10. Vassell
    I think there's a good player in there, but nobody is going to be brave enough to give him a contract after the last few years. I hope he goes elsewhere and scores a hatful of goals
